Kure Beach, NC vs Rich Square, NC
The cost of living difference between Kure Beach, NC and Rich Square, NC is dramatic. Rich Square is 101.5% cheaper than Kure Beach,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Kure Beach has a cost index of 127 while Rich Square sits at 63,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Kure Beach is $1,373/month compared to $781/month in Rich Square — a 76%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Rich Square is more affordable at $78,300 median vs $633,800.
Median household income in Kure Beach is $102,292 compared to $38,621 in Rich Square (+164.9%). While Kure Beach is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Kure Beach spend roughly 16.1% of their income on rent, less than the 24.3% in Rich Square.
